Business
Capricor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: CAPR) is a clinical-stage biotechnology company that develops transformative cell and exosome-based therapeutics for the treatment of Duchenne muscular dystrophy and other rare diseases with high unmet medical needs. Founded in 2005 and headquartered in San Diego, California, the company focuses on allogeneic cardiosphere-derived cells and engineered exosomes, targeting primary markets in the United States, Japan, and Europe through strategic partnerships. Its lead product candidate, deramiocel (also known as CAP-1002), comprises cardiosphere-derived cells that provide immunomodulatory, anti-fibrotic, anti-inflammatory, and regenerative effects via exosome-mediated mechanisms, including microRNAs that alter gene expression to reduce inflammation and promote tissue repair in dystrophinopathies; deramiocel has completed the Phase 3 HOPE-3 trial, demonstrating statistically significant improvements in skeletal and cardiac function, building on durable benefits observed in the HOPE-2 trial and its over 48-month open-label extension. The company advances a proprietary StealthX exosome platform for precision-engineered therapeutics, including targeted delivery of RNA, proteins, small molecules, and vaccines; this encompasses preclinical and early-stage programs such as an NIAID-funded Phase 1 exosome-based vaccine candidate for infectious diseases with topline data expected in early 2026, alongside CAP-2003 for DMD and broader applications in inflammatory and regenerative medicine. Capricor maintains license agreements with institutions including Johns Hopkins University, University of Rome, Cedars-Sinai Medical Center, and Life Technologies to support its cell and exosome technologies. In recent developments, Capricor announced positive topline results from the pivotal Phase 3 HOPE-3 study of deramiocel in December 2025, prompting plans for a Biologics License Application resubmission to the FDA by year-end incorporating this data to address prior manufacturing observations from a Complete Response Letter; the company expanded its partnership with Nippon Shinyaku Co., Ltd. and NS Pharma, Inc. in 2024 to include exclusive commercialization and distribution rights for deramiocel in Europe alongside the existing U.S. and Japan agreements, which provide upfront payments, development and sales milestones up to approximately $89 million, and double-digit royalties. Capricor reports a cash position of approximately $99 million as of Q3 2025, sufficient to fund operations into late 2026 amid commercial launch preparations for potential 2026 market introduction and ongoing exosome platform advancement.
